Eckerd Holds On To Top Lady Mocs 71-69

ST. PETERSBURG - Forced to play catch-up most of the night, the Lady Mocs never could come all the way back and wound up dropping a 71-69 Sunshine State Conference decision to last-place Eckerd here Wednesday night.

The Tritons' Ashley Lutz sank a free throw to break a 15-15 tie with 13:35 left in the first half and Eckerd never trailed from that point. The lead grew to 33-20 with 4:44 left in the half before the Moccasins were able to trim it to four, 35-31, at halftime.

Trailing 55-44 with 11:50 remaining in the game, the Moccasins went on a 16-6 run to narrow the margin to 61-60 on a free throw by Chelsea Johnson with 5:51 to go, but could not get any closer.

A three-pointer by Megan Dzikas with 27 seconds left cut Eckerd's lead to 71-69 and the Moccasins got the ball back after a missed Eckerd shot, but turned it over with six seconds left and Eckerd ran out the clock.

Nicolle DiRaimo led FSC with 20 points and added nine rebounds, six assists and two blocks. Michaela Hawley had 15 points, Chelsea Johnson scored 13 and Megan Dzikas tossed in 10.

Johnson and Dzikas had a cold shooting night, as they combined to go 8-for-30 from the field and 3-for-13 from three-point range.

Lutz led Eckerd (8-12, 2-9 SSC) with 22 points. Tijana Brdar added 17, with Taylor Young and Krystal Charles combining for 23 points off the bench.

The Moccasins (17-6, 7-5 SSC), who are ranked fifth in this week's South Region rankings, are on the road Saturday for a 5:30 p.m. game at Lynn.
